The new full-length trailer for Tim Burton's Frankenweenie in 3D was released online June 26, featuring the methods of Dr. Frankenstein to bring a boy's beloved dog Sparky back to life.

This stop-motion animated film, by the director of Dark Shadows and Alice In Wonderland, began as a short film by the director in 1984, a heartwarming tale of a science experiment that takes a monstrous twist.
Reminiscent of the director's film The Nightmare Before Christmas, the black-and-white footage reveals what happens when word spreads about the stitched-up canine creation.
The film features the voices of Winona Ryder (The Black Swan), Martin Short (Madagascar 3), Christopher Lee (Hugo) and Martin Landau (Entourage).
Frankenweenie in 3D will be released October 4-5 in Russia, Hungary and North America, on October 17-18 in the UK and other European markets, in Australia, Asian and Latin American territories and France on October 31, Halloween, then Brazil in November and Japan in December.
